Are you in possession of a valid permit to handle explosive substances and wish to carry out a blasting operation? Then you must report this blasting to the local competent authority.
If, for example, you want to carry out a building or chimney blast or a blast during road construction work, you must notify the local competent authority. The notification must be made by the holder of a permit in accordance with the Explosives Act. If changes are made to the contents or the original documents after the notification has been made, the person obliged to notify must also notify the local competent authority.
Note: Blasting that is not carried out with explosives but with pyrotechnic objects (rock-breaking cartridges) must also be reported.
You do not have to report blasting in facilities that are approved in accordance with Section 4 of the Federal Immission Control Act and the approval includes blasting (for example, this may be the case for quarries).
